What is a part time remote GIS data entry?

A Part Time Remote GIS Data Entry job involves inputting, updating, and verifying geographic information system (GIS) data from a remote location, usually from home. Employees in this role work flexible hours and use specialized software to enter geographic coordinates, map features, and other spatial data into digital databases. The position often supports organizations in fields like urban planning, environmental studies, or logistics by ensuring accurate mapping and spatial analysis. Strong attention to detail, basic computer skills, and familiarity with GIS concepts are typically required. This job is ideal for those seeking flexible, remote work involving both data entry and geography.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time remote GIS data entry specialist?

To excel in a Part Time Remote GIS Data Entry role, you need strong attention to detail, data accuracy skills, and a basic understanding of geographic information systems,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with GIS software such as ArcGIS or QGIS, as well as proficiency in data entry tools like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ets, is commonly required. Self-motivation, time management, and clear communication are important soft skills for successful remote work and collaboration. These skills ensure that spatial data is accurately entered and maintained, supporting reliable analysis and decision-making for geographic projects.

What are some common challenges faced in a part time remote GIS data entry role, and how can they be managed?

One common challenge in a part-time remote GIS data entry role is maintaining accuracy and consistency when handling large datasets from different sources. To manage this, it’s important to follow established data entry protocols, regularly communicate with your team or supervisor, and utilize GIS software tools effectively. Additionally, remote work can sometimes lead to feelings of isolation, so staying connected through virtual meetings and collaborative platforms is beneficial. Balancing part-time hours with deadlines also requires strong time management skills to ensure quality work without last-minute rushes.
